首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到17条相似文献,搜索用时 127 毫秒
1.
针对化工过程复杂非线性,并且含有噪声和随机干扰的特点,提出利用小波去噪与核主元分析(KPCA)相结合的方法来进行故障检测,既可以达到去噪、抗干扰的目的,又可以将输入空间中复杂的非线性问题转化为特征空间中的线性问题,从而解决了主元分析(PCA)方法在非线性过程中性能差的问题.并将该方法应用于Tennessee Eastm...  相似文献   

2.
提出一种基于小波去噪与核熵成分分析(WT-KECA)的方法。首先,利用小波变换对原始过程数据去噪,然后利用核熵元分析(KECA)进行数据降维与特征提取,保证信息量损失最小,并根据统计量SPE和T2来判断是否发生故障。通过对TE过程的仿真研究,验证了该方法的有效性和可行性。  相似文献   

3.
基于小波核聚类的非高斯过程故障检测方法   总被引:2,自引:2,他引:0       下载免费PDF全文
王坤  杜文莉  钱锋 《化工学报》2011,62(2):427-432
针对工业过程检测变量具有的非线性和非高斯性等特点,提出了一种基于小波核聚类的核主元分析(WKPCA)方法来处理过程数据的非线性特性,同时引用支持向量数据描述(SVDD)对过程进行建模。本算法先根据Morlet小波具有多分辨分析和能以更高的精度逼近任意函数的特点,将其构建为小波核函数,可以增强KPCA的非线性核映射和抗噪能力,然后在映射后的特征空间中进行均值聚类分析,选择每个聚类中展现特征中心的数据,大大减少了核函数的计算量;最后通过SVDD提出监控指标来描述过程的非高斯特性。将上述方法用在一个标准仿真平台Tennessee-Eastman上,结果表明,该方法能及时有效地检测出系统产生的故障和异常情况。  相似文献   

4.
针对复杂工业系统动态非线性故障检测过程精度低和计算量大的问题,提出了一种改进的动态核主元分析故障检测方法,该方法首先利用不可区分度剔除相关程度较小或者不相关变量,减少数据量,然后通过观测值扩展对筛选后的新数据构建增广矩阵,并对矩阵使用核主元分析提取变量数据的非线性空间相关特征,最后通过监测T2和SPE两种统计量诊断出系统发生故障及识别故障变量。仿真实验证明,该方法能对风力发电机故障进行有效监测和诊断,与KPCA方法相比,改进的动态核主元分析方法对微小故障更为敏感。  相似文献   

5.
针对工业过程的多模态和非高斯特性,提出一种基于改进局部熵主元分析(ILEPCA)的故障检测方法。引入k近邻的均值对局部概率密度函数进行改进,构造改进的局部熵数据剔除多模态和非高斯特性。对改进的局部熵数据建立主元分析(PCA)模型,根据核密度估计计算控制限。对于测试数据,运用改进的局部熵算法预处理后,向PCA模型上投影,计算统计量。通过比较统计量与控制限来进行故障检测。把该方法应用到数值例子和半导体过程故障检测,仿真结果表明,与PCA、核主元分析(KPCA)和局部熵PCA (LEPCA)相比,ILEPCA算法在具有多模态和非高斯特性的工业过程故障检测中具有明显的优越性。  相似文献   

6.
翟坤  杜文霞  吕锋  辛涛  句希源 《化工学报》2019,70(2):716-722
针对复杂工业系统动态非线性故障检测过程精度低和计算量大的问题,提出了一种改进的动态核主元分析故障检测方法,该方法首先利用不可区分度剔除相关程度较小或者不相关变量,减少数据量,然后通过观测值扩展对筛选后的新数据构建增广矩阵,并对矩阵使用核主元分析提取变量数据的非线性空间相关特征,最后通过监测T 2SPE 两种统计量诊断出系统发生故障及识别故障变量。仿真实验证明,该方法能对风力发电机故障进行有效监测和诊断,与KPCA方法相比,改进的动态核主元分析方法对微小故障更为敏感。  相似文献   

7.
针对工业过程故障检测问题,提出了一种改进多尺度主元分析方法。首先针对过程数据所具有的随机性、非平稳性及含有大量噪声等特点,提出了一种改进小波变换阈值去噪方法,移除原始过程数据中的大部分高频随机噪声,提高数据的置信度,然后应用小波多尺度分解将每个变量依次分解成逼近系数和多个尺度的细节系数,在各个尺度矩阵建立相应的主元分析模型,以模型统计量控制限为阈值,对小波系数重构得到综合尺度主元分析模型。将该改进多尺度主元分析方法应用于丙烯聚合过程监测与故障诊断研究中,研究结果表明,与传统多尺度主元分析相比,改进多尺度主元分析减少了误报率和漏报率,提高了过程监测与故障诊断的精度。  相似文献   

8.
范玉刚  李平  宋执环 《化工学报》2006,57(11):2670-2676
基于主元分析(PCA)的统计检测方法已经被广泛应用于各种化工过程的故障检测和识别.移动主元分析(moving principal component analysis,简称MPCA)算法基于PCA,根据主元子空间的变化来判断故障是否发生.然而,基于主元分析的统计检测方法是线性方法,无法有效应用于非线性系统.因此,提出一种适合于非线性系统的故障检测方法——基于核主角(kernel principal angle,简称KPA)的故障检测方法,其基本思想与MPCA相似,主要内容包括构建特征子空间和核主角测量两部分.TE过程故障检测仿真实验证明,基于核主角的故障检测方法优于传统的多元统计检测方法(cMSPC)和MPCA.  相似文献   

9.
针对传统核主元分析(KPCA)方法难以有效检测微小故障的问题,提出一种基于双层局部核主元分析(double-level local kernel principal component analysis,DLKPCA)的非线性过程微小故障检测方法。该方法从变量和样本两个角度来挖掘数据内部的局部信息,以提高故障检测能力。首先,利用变量分块思想,基于不同变量与核主元之间互信息相关度的相似性,将所有过程变量划分多个局部变量块。然后,构建基于得分向量和特征值的残差函数以挖掘样本局部信息。最后利用贝叶斯融合策略对各块的结果进行融合。在田纳西-伊斯曼基准过程的仿真结果表明,在微小故障检测方面,本文所提方法具有比传统KPCA方法更好的故障检测性能。  相似文献   

10.
卢春红  熊伟丽  顾晓峰 《化工学报》2014,65(12):4866-4874
针对一类非线性多模态的化工过程,提出一种基于概率核主元的混合模型(PKPCAM),并利用贝叶斯推理策略进行过程监控与故障诊断.在提出的模型中, 每个操作模态由一个局部化的概率核主元分量描述,从而构建的一系列分量对应了不同的操作模态.首先,将过程数据从原始的度量空间投影到高维特征空间;其次,在该特征空间建立概率主元混合模型,从概率角度刻画数据集的多个局部分量特征;最后,在提取的核主元分量内获得测试样本的后验概率,结合模态内的马氏距离贡献度,提出基于贝叶斯推理的全局概率指标进行故障检测,同时利用模态内变量的相对贡献度,基于全局贡献度指标进行故障诊断.利用TEP仿真平台,与基于k均值聚类的次级主元分析和核主元分析的方法进行了对比分析,验证了提出的贝叶斯推理的PKPCAM方法对非线性多模态过程进行故障检测与诊断的可行性和有效性.  相似文献   

11.
利用核独立成分分析(KICA)进行非线性特征提取,然后用最小二乘支持向量机建立故障分类模型。研究表明,不同核函数对模型的性能有很大影响。利用已有核函数构造混合核函数,提出基于混合核函数的KI-CA-LSSVM故障分类方法,并应用到某石化企业的润滑油生产过程。实验结果表明该方法具有很高的分类和泛化能力。  相似文献   

12.
In this paper the multiscale kernel principal component analysis (MSKPCA) based on sliding median filter (SFM) is proposed for fault detection in nonlinear system with outliers. The MSKPCA based on SFM (SFM-MSKPCA) algorithm is first proposed and applied to process monitoring. The advantages of SFM-MSKPCA are: (1) the dynamical multiscale monitoring method is proposed which combining the Kronecker production, the wavelet decomposition technique, the sliding median filter technique and KPCA. The Kronecker production is first used to build the dynamical model; (2) there are more disturbances and noises in dynamical processes compared to static processes. The sliding median filter technique is used to remove the disturbances and noises; (3) SFM-MSKPCA gives nonlinear dynamic interpretation compared to MSPCA; (4) by decomposing the original data into multiple scales, SFM-MSKPCA analyze the dynamical data at different scales, reconstruct scales contained important information by IDWT, eliminate the effects of the noises in the original data compared to kernel principal component analysis (KPCA). To demonstrate the feasibility of the SFM-MSKPCA method, its process monitoring abilities are tested by simulation examples, and compared with the monitoring abilities of the KPCA and MSPCA method on the quantitative basis. The fault detection results and the comparison show the superiority of SFM-MSKPCA in fault detection.  相似文献   

13.
Multivariate process monitoring and analysis based on multi-scale KPLS   总被引:1,自引:0,他引:1  
In the paper, a new multi-scale KPLS (MSKPLS) algorithm combining kernel partial least square (KPLS) and wavelet analysis is proposed for investigating the multi-scale nature of nonlinear process. The MSKPLS first decomposes the process measurements into separated multi-scale components using on-line wavelet transform, and then the resultant multi-scale data blocks are modeled in the framework of multi-block KPLS algorithm which can describe the global relationships across the entire scales as well as the localized features within each scale. To demonstrate the feasibility of the MSKPLS method, its process monitoring abilities were tested for a real industrial data set, and compared with the monitoring abilities of the standard KPLS method. The results clearly showed that the MSKPLS was superior to the standard KPLS, especially in that it could provide additional scale-level information about the fault characteristics as well as more sensitive fault detection ability.  相似文献   

14.
In order to detect abnormal events at different scales, a number of multiscale multivariate statistical process control (MSPC) approaches which combine a multivariate linear projection model with multiresolution analysis have been suggested. In this paper, a new nonlinear multiscale-MSPC method is proposed to address multivariate process performance monitoring and in particular fault diagnostics in nonlinear processes. A kernel principal component analysis (KPCA) model, which not only captures nonlinear relationships between variables but also reduces the dimensionality of the data, is built with the reconstructed data obtained by performing wavelet transform and inverse wavelet transform sequentially on measured data. A guideline is given for both off-line and on-line implementations of the approach. Two monitoring statistics used in multiscale KPCA-based process monitoring are used for fault detection. Furthermore, variable contributions to monitoring statistics are also derived by calculating the derivative of the monitoring statistics with respect to the variables. An intensive simulation study on a continuous stirred tank reactor process and a comparison of the proposed approach with several existing methods in terms of false alarm rate, missed alarm rate and detection delay, demonstrate that the proposed method for detecting and identifying faults outperforms current approaches.  相似文献   

15.
基于RISOMAP的非线性过程故障检测方法   总被引:8,自引:6,他引:2       下载免费PDF全文
张妮  田学民  蔡连芳 《化工学报》2013,64(6):2125-2130
化工过程监控数据存在非线性特点,且过程常常运行于多个模态,针对该类问题,提出基于相对等距离映射(relative isometric mapping, RISOMAP)的过程故障检测方法,该方法采用相对测地距离构造高维空间的距离关系阵,运用多维尺度变换(MDS)计算其低维嵌入输出,从高维数据中提取子流形信息和残差信息分别构造监控统计量进行故障检测,同时运用核ridge回归在线计算测试数据的低维输出,核矩阵通过综合相似度进行更新。数值算例和TE过程的仿真结果表明,RISOMAP方法可以更为有效地实施故障检测,故障检测的灵敏度较高,同时也为基于流形学习的多模态过程故障检测的实施提供了一条思路。  相似文献   

16.
基于双层局部KPCA的非线性过程微小故障检测方法   总被引:1,自引:0,他引:1  
邓晓刚  邓佳伟  曹玉苹  王磊 《化工学报》2018,69(7):3092-3100
针对传统核主元分析(KPCA)方法难以有效检测微小故障的问题,提出一种基于双层局部核主元分析(double-level local kernel principal component analysis,DLKPCA)的非线性过程微小故障检测方法。该方法从变量和样本两个角度来挖掘数据内部的局部信息,以提高故障检测能力。首先,利用变量分块思想,基于不同变量与核主元之间互信息相关度的相似性,将所有过程变量划分多个局部变量块。然后,构建基于得分向量和特征值的残差函数以挖掘样本局部信息。最后利用贝叶斯融合策略对各块的结果进行融合。在田纳西-伊斯曼基准过程的仿真结果表明,在微小故障检测方面,本文所提方法具有比传统KPCA方法更好的故障检测性能。  相似文献   

17.
韩宇  李俊芳  高强  田宇  禹国刚 《化工学报》2020,71(3):1254-1263
基于核熵主成分分析方法的统计模型仅利用正常工况下数据进行建模,而忽略了监控系统数据库中一些已知类别的先前故障数据。为了利用先前故障数据中包含的故障信息来增强故障检测性能,提出了一种故障判别增强KECA (fault discriminant enhanced kernel entropy component analysis, FDKECA)算法。该法通过采用无监督学习和监督学习方法建立模型,同时监测非线性核熵主成分(kernel entropy component, KEC)和故障判别成分(fault discriminant component, FDC)两类数据特征。此外,利用贝叶斯推理将相应的监视统计信息转换为故障概率,并通过加权两个子模型的结果来构建基于总体概率的监视统计量。通过数值仿真和田纳西伊斯曼(Tennessee Eastman, TE)过程仿真实验,证明和传统KECA相比,FDKECA算法能够有效利用故障数据提高故障检测率。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号